📌  相关文章
📜  linux 添加到路径 - Shell-Bash (1)

📅  最后修改于: 2023-12-03 15:17:23.367000             🧑  作者: Mango

将 Linux 添加到路径 - Shell/Bash

当在使用 Shell 或 Bash 命令行界面时,有时候我们需要将某个程序或脚本的路径添加到系统环境变量中,这使得我们可以在任何目录下都能方便地执行该程序。本文将介绍如何将 Linux 命令或脚本的路径添加到环境变量中。

什么是环境变量?

环境变量是操作系统中用于保存系统相关信息的一种机制。它包含了一系列的键值对,每个键值对表示一个具体的变量。在 Linux 中,环境变量可以在用户登录时自动加载,并在整个会话期间保持有效。

PATH 环境变量

PATH 是一个特殊的环境变量,它用于存储可执行文件的路径。当我们在命令行中输入一个命令时,系统会在 PATH 变量列出的路径中查找可执行文件,并执行该命令。

如何将 Linux 程序添加到 PATH 变量?

要将 Linux 程序或脚本的路径添加到 PATH 变量,有两种常见的方法:暂时生效和永久生效。

暂时生效

如果只想在当前会话中暂时添加一个路径到 PATH 变量,可以使用以下命令:

export PATH=$PATH:/path/to/program

上述命令将 /path/to/program 添加到了已有的 PATH 变量之后,$PATH 表示已有的 PATH 变量的值。

永久生效

如果想让某个路径永久添加到 PATH 变量中,需要编辑 Shell 的配置文件(比如 .bashrc.bash_profile),在其中添加以下代码:

export PATH=$PATH:/path/to/program

确保将 /path/to/program 替换为你想要添加的真实路径。

保存配置文件后,需要重新加载配置文件或重新启动 Shell 才能使更改生效。

检查 PATH 变量的值

为了确定 PATH 变量是否已经包含了你添加的路径,可以使用以下命令进行检查:

echo $PATH

命令将会打印出 PATH 变量的当前值,其中包括了添加的路径。

结论

通过将 Linux 程序或脚本的路径添加到 PATH 变量,我们可以方便地在任何目录下运行该程序。可以根据需要选择使用暂时生效或永久生效的方法。

希望本文对你了解如何将 Linux 添加到路径有所帮助。